From 04f5aba803f077167c0e36f4f084a5fb5f727631 Mon Sep 17 00:00:00 2001 From: Newton Filho Date: Sun, 21 Jul 2024 17:15:06 +0100 Subject: [PATCH 1/4] Update README.md Adjustments on the Example class --- README.md |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) diff --git a/README.md b/README.md index e5e44cd8..3e1f5672 100644 --- a/README.md +++ b/README.md @@ -81,11 +81,14 @@ Please follow the [installation](#installation) instruction and execute the foll ```java // Import classes: +import java.util.Arrays; import com.onesignal.client.ApiClient; import com.onesignal.client.ApiException; import com.onesignal.client.Configuration; import com.onesignal.client.auth.*; -import com.onesignal.client.models.*; +import com.onesignal.client.model.CreateNotificationSuccessResponse; +import com.onesignal.client.model.Notification; +import com.onesignal.client.model.StringMap; import com.onesignal.client.api.DefaultApi; public class Example { @@ -106,14 +109,14 @@ public class Example { return notification; } - public static void main(String[] args) { + public static void main(String[] args) throws ApiException { // Setting up the client ApiClient defaultClient = Configuration.getDefaultApiClient(); HttpBearerAuth appKey = (HttpBearerAuth) defaultClient.getAuthentication("app_key"); appKey.setBearerToken(appKeyToken); HttpBearerAuth userKey = (HttpBearerAuth) defaultClient.getAuthentication("user_key"); userKey.setBearerToken(userKeyToken); - api = new DefaultApi(defaultClient); + DefaultApi api = new DefaultApi(defaultClient); // Setting up the notification Notification notification = createNotification(); @@ -122,7 +125,7 @@ public class Example { CreateNotificationSuccessResponse response = api.createNotification(notification); // Checking the result - System.out.print(response.getId(); + System.out.print(response.getId()); } } From 3602c08ccdb8707e2d4d0d88567cf9022fd08330 Mon Sep 17 00:00:00 2001 From: Newton Filho Date: Sun, 21 Jul 2024 17:16:41 +0100 Subject: [PATCH 2/4] Update README.md Add first the example to clone repo --- README.md |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/README.md b/README.md index 3e1f5672..8af2e15b 100644 --- a/README.md +++ b/README.md @@ -19,6 +19,12 @@ Building the API client library requires: ## Installation +First, clone the repo, simply execute: + +```shell +git clone https://github.com/OneSignal/onesignal-java-api.git +``` + To install the API client library to your local Maven repository, simply execute: ```shell From 98010ca7c57318c8aaa8997d03074271640b990e Mon Sep 17 00:00:00 2001 From: Newton Filho Date: Sun, 21 Jul 2024 17:18:20 +0100 Subject: [PATCH 3/4] Update README.md Better clarify instructions to Maven users --- README.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/README.md b/README.md index 8af2e15b..5de8d062 100644 --- a/README.md +++ b/README.md @@ -41,7 +41,7 @@ Refer to the [OSSRH Guide](http://central.sonatype.org/pages/ossrh-guide.html) f ### Maven users -Add this dependency to your project's POM: +After you build and install to your local Maven repo ou deploy to the project repository, add this dependency to your project's POM: ```xml From d0e57927266405ef3cfa4fc70af56a279d8f7301 Mon Sep 17 00:00:00 2001 From: semantic-release-bot Date: Thu, 5 Mar 2026 10:17:33 +0000 Subject: [PATCH 4/4] chore(release): 1.0.0 ## 1.0.0 (2026-03-05) ### Features * add v2.1.0 package updates ([396600b](https://github.com/NewtonMan/onesignal-java-api/commit/396600ba4a4cf8fae4f5b76d6da0a2de62a267b0)) * add v2.2.0 package updates ([b220ea8](https://github.com/NewtonMan/onesignal-java-api/commit/b220ea870a73fcdad37c42188fb27ae714401e4b)) * add v2.2.0 package updates ([46ba07a](https://github.com/NewtonMan/onesignal-java-api/commit/46ba07a9a59d21feae12aecf7d1a4d426d60c9a4)) * add v5.0.0-beta1 package updates ([c1fbcf6](https://github.com/NewtonMan/onesignal-java-api/commit/c1fbcf60896529f2e26c2c7aa466e07f232c3f01)) * add v5.1.0-beta1 package updates ([c819297](https://github.com/NewtonMan/onesignal-java-api/commit/c819297f3083842935cfdc300de6dda3cb56b36f)) * add v5.2.0-beta1 package updates ([c493f79](https://github.com/NewtonMan/onesignal-java-api/commit/c493f79aa7df917ae8ddbfade7a12f029e03c5ea)) * add v5.2.0-beta1 package updates ([cce80aa](https://github.com/NewtonMan/onesignal-java-api/commit/cce80aae2d9b3f8714aefc7f2abd07ecda40b473)) * add v5.2.0-beta1 package updates ([bf1380d](https://github.com/NewtonMan/onesignal-java-api/commit/bf1380dd7a58a414ce33853008a693be5c7b5506)) * add v5.2.0-beta1 package updates ([de99c8a](https://github.com/NewtonMan/onesignal-java-api/commit/de99c8aca51f22b546ad75c90714e25cd2a46993)) * add v5.2.1-beta1 package updates ([c8fbe0a](https://github.com/NewtonMan/onesignal-java-api/commit/c8fbe0af39aed3fdff5c7b481e4a184c355cb103)) * add v5.3.0-beta1 package updates ([670ae2c](https://github.com/NewtonMan/onesignal-java-api/commit/670ae2c24f5a6ca44e2a312dd146205a1adf9f31)) * add v5.3.0-beta1 package updates ([697b2f8](https://github.com/NewtonMan/onesignal-java-api/commit/697b2f8e4742c30bed78db3a875767134708e65f)) * add v5.3.0-beta1 package updates ([90f6f83](https://github.com/NewtonMan/onesignal-java-api/commit/90f6f830558a2ee76eacfce47337450ea27d3cc1)) * add v5.3.0-beta1 package updates ([a6d6c75](https://github.com/NewtonMan/onesignal-java-api/commit/a6d6c7554ede42144b53e5f160bf97d28567617b)) * add v5.3.0-beta1 package updates ([1dceaaf](https://github.com/NewtonMan/onesignal-java-api/commit/1dceaaf039848e8f69cc00c2fa96fb80d6d23f02)) * add v5.3.0-beta1 package updates ([a8d3d46](https://github.com/NewtonMan/onesignal-java-api/commit/a8d3d46445e2735efb77e447493ee168ab2a00b8)) * add v5.3.0-beta1 package updates ([abdb323](https://github.com/NewtonMan/onesignal-java-api/commit/abdb323a8343947cec6f40772f8e0baa181848aa)) [skip ci] --- CHANGELOG.md | 23 +++++++++++++++++++++++ 1 file changed, 23 insertions(+) create mode 100644 CHANGELOG.md diff --git a/CHANGELOG.md b/CHANGELOG.md new file mode 100644 index 00000000..59da762e --- /dev/null +++ b/CHANGELOG.md @@ -0,0 +1,23 @@ +# Changelog + +## 1.0.0 (2026-03-05) + +### Features + +* add v2.1.0 package updates ([396600b](https://github.com/NewtonMan/onesignal-java-api/commit/396600ba4a4cf8fae4f5b76d6da0a2de62a267b0)) +* add v2.2.0 package updates ([b220ea8](https://github.com/NewtonMan/onesignal-java-api/commit/b220ea870a73fcdad37c42188fb27ae714401e4b)) +* add v2.2.0 package updates ([46ba07a](https://github.com/NewtonMan/onesignal-java-api/commit/46ba07a9a59d21feae12aecf7d1a4d426d60c9a4)) +* add v5.0.0-beta1 package updates ([c1fbcf6](https://github.com/NewtonMan/onesignal-java-api/commit/c1fbcf60896529f2e26c2c7aa466e07f232c3f01)) +* add v5.1.0-beta1 package updates ([c819297](https://github.com/NewtonMan/onesignal-java-api/commit/c819297f3083842935cfdc300de6dda3cb56b36f)) +* add v5.2.0-beta1 package updates ([c493f79](https://github.com/NewtonMan/onesignal-java-api/commit/c493f79aa7df917ae8ddbfade7a12f029e03c5ea)) +* add v5.2.0-beta1 package updates ([cce80aa](https://github.com/NewtonMan/onesignal-java-api/commit/cce80aae2d9b3f8714aefc7f2abd07ecda40b473)) +* add v5.2.0-beta1 package updates ([bf1380d](https://github.com/NewtonMan/onesignal-java-api/commit/bf1380dd7a58a414ce33853008a693be5c7b5506)) +* add v5.2.0-beta1 package updates ([de99c8a](https://github.com/NewtonMan/onesignal-java-api/commit/de99c8aca51f22b546ad75c90714e25cd2a46993)) +* add v5.2.1-beta1 package updates ([c8fbe0a](https://github.com/NewtonMan/onesignal-java-api/commit/c8fbe0af39aed3fdff5c7b481e4a184c355cb103)) +* add v5.3.0-beta1 package updates ([670ae2c](https://github.com/NewtonMan/onesignal-java-api/commit/670ae2c24f5a6ca44e2a312dd146205a1adf9f31)) +* add v5.3.0-beta1 package updates ([697b2f8](https://github.com/NewtonMan/onesignal-java-api/commit/697b2f8e4742c30bed78db3a875767134708e65f)) +* add v5.3.0-beta1 package updates ([90f6f83](https://github.com/NewtonMan/onesignal-java-api/commit/90f6f830558a2ee76eacfce47337450ea27d3cc1)) +* add v5.3.0-beta1 package updates ([a6d6c75](https://github.com/NewtonMan/onesignal-java-api/commit/a6d6c7554ede42144b53e5f160bf97d28567617b)) +* add v5.3.0-beta1 package updates ([1dceaaf](https://github.com/NewtonMan/onesignal-java-api/commit/1dceaaf039848e8f69cc00c2fa96fb80d6d23f02)) +* add v5.3.0-beta1 package updates ([a8d3d46](https://github.com/NewtonMan/onesignal-java-api/commit/a8d3d46445e2735efb77e447493ee168ab2a00b8)) +* add v5.3.0-beta1 package updates ([abdb323](https://github.com/NewtonMan/onesignal-java-api/commit/abdb323a8343947cec6f40772f8e0baa181848aa))